Bulldogs Battle Mavericks in First Game of Season Series

Senior forward (#22) Matthew Hezekiah was selected to the Preseason All-MEAC First Team.
GAME NOTES
OMAHA, Neb
—The South Carolina State Bulldogs will battle the Nebraska-Omaha Mavericks in the first game of a season series Tuesday at Ralston Arena. Tip-off is set for 7 p.m.

Tuesday's contest between the Mavericks and Bulldogs will mark the first meeting in school history. The two teams will meet again next week as part of a home-and-home series, as Nebraska-Omaha will travel to Orangeburg, SC on Monday, Nov. 25.

Coach Murray Garvin and the Bulldogs (1-3) enters tonight's contest after dropping a tough 83-56 contest tp Big Ten foe the University of Nebraska in Lincoln on Sunday. Sophomore transfer guard Jordan Smith led the way with 14 points and three 3-pointers, while senior guard Adama "Louis" Adams added 11 and four assists.

Freshman forward Patrick Kirksey played a key role off the bench with nine points and eight rebounds on the day.

The Mavericks (2-2) are led by Preseason All-Summit First Team senior guard Justin Simmons with 9.0 ppg, while junior guard CJ Carter is the leading scorer with 18.8 ppg and 3.3 rpg, and sophomore guard Devin Patterson with 11.8 points per outing.

The Bulldogs are led by senior forward All-MEAC First Team performer Matthew Hezekiah with 15.7 ppg, while Smith adds 10.0 points and Adams chips in 9.0 per outing.

South Carolina State will return to action on Saturday when they host Voorhees College in a non-conference matchup. Tip-off is 7 p.m.
